titleOfInvention Ultrasonic coupling method
abstract An ultrasonic transducer is adhered to and electrically and ultrasonically coupled with a surface by means of a room temperature vulcanizing material which is stable when subjected to high temperature and radiation levels. The RTV material is formed from either a vinylmethyl or polyphenyl siloxane matrix containing an iron oxide filler-binder, a cross-linking agent and a finely divided, uniformly dispersed conductive powder. The conductive powder for use in radiation environments is either palladium or graphite and it is homogeneously dispersed by using a temporary dispersing agent.
